Zámek Horní Branná, Renaissance château in Horní Branná, Czech Republic.

Zámek Horní Branná is a Renaissance-era château featuring symmetrical structures with geometric patterns that reflect 16th-century architectural design principles. The building displays the precise proportions characteristic of that period.

The château was founded in 1582 by Zdeněk of Wallenstein and later became home to the philosopher John Amos Comenius. The building suffered considerable damage during the Thirty Years' War.

The château holds a museum dedicated to John Amos Comenius, a Czech philosopher and pedagogue whose ideas shaped education in the region. Visitors can explore how his teachings were connected to this place.
